Understanding Dolphin Behavior

To understand the likelihood of a dolphin biting a human, we must first dive into the depths of dolphin behavior. Dolphins are highly intelligent and social creatures, with complex social structures and communication patterns.

Dolphins in the Wild vs. Captivity

The environment plays a crucial role in the behavior of dolphins. In the wild, they roam freely, but in captivity, they can become stressed or agitated, which could potentially lead to aggressive behavior.

FAQs

  1. Can a dolphin bite be dangerous to humans? Dolphins have strong jaws and sharp teeth; a bite can be serious, but such incidents are extremely rare.
  2. Why might a dolphin bite a person? A bite may occur if a dolphin is feeling threatened, stressed, or if it’s been provoked.
  3. Are dolphins friendly to all humans? While many dolphins are curious and friendly, each dolphin is an individual with its own temperament.
  4. How should I behave when swimming with dolphins? Always follow guidelines, avoid sudden movements, and never touch or feed wild dolphins unless in a regulated environment.
  5. What should I do if a dolphin displays aggressive behavior? Keep calm, slowly and gently try to distance yourself, and avoid direct eye contact or sudden movements.
